What are the requirements for becoming a Tracker?
Minimum legal requirements
In the United States, the rules to become a process server vary from state to state. In many states, the main requirement is that you are over 18 years of age and you are not a party to the case. Other states mandate licensure or registration with your state or county. Details of state-by-state requirements can be reviewed on the ServeManager website.
Additional InfoTrack Exchange requirements
In addition to meeting the minimum legal requirements in your state, InfoTrack Exchange also requires the following of all Trackers:
That you can pass our background check (see How and why does InfoTrack Exchange conduct background checks on Trackers).
That you have a valid driver's license.
That you have valid auto insurance.
That you have been serving papers for at least 12 months.
That you are not a current employee of InfoTrack US, Inc. or any of our subsidiaries.
